📚数据库设计(第一范式,第二范式,第三范式)💻
发布时间:2025-03-18 07:31:40来源:
在数据库的世界里,规范化是确保数据质量与效率的关键步骤。第一范式(1NF)就像是给数据穿上整齐的外衣,要求每个字段都不可再分,就像每块拼图都有明确的位置。例如,一个学生信息表中,电话号码不应包含多个号码,需要拆分为多个记录。
进入第二范式(2NF),我们需要消除部分依赖,确保所有非主属性完全依赖于主键。这就好比把杂乱无章的工具箱整理好,让每个工具都有固定的归处,避免重复存储,提高查询效率。
第三范式(3NF)则更进一步,去除传递依赖,让数据更加纯净。想象一下,如果知道一个人的名字就能推断出他的地址,那说明存在不必要的冗余,而3NF会帮你剔除这些多余的信息关联,让数据库运行更流畅。🌟
通过这三个层次的规范化处理,数据库不仅变得更健壮,也更容易维护和扩展!✨
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。